Fusing elements of electro and dance-pop, freestyle music was largely a product of the Latino communities of New York City and Miami in the early to mid-’80s; it began being played regularly on pop radio stations toward the end of the decade.

Aside from its ability to make your booty shake and lift your spirits like no other, freestyle also lent itself to the most AMAZING music videos on the planet.

Pretty much exclusively filmed in and around New York City apartment buildings, warehouses, and parks, these videos were a true sensory treat.
